POSITION DESCRIPTION:

Assist with supervising a safe and well-organized childcare program by planning and participating in group activities with children at a designated day camp site. This is a very high energy program requiring positive interaction with the children continually throughout the day.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Attend all scheduled staff meetings and trainings.
  • Establish a positive relationship with each child.
  • Develop positive relationships with parents and staff.
  • Develop weekly activities for a group of 12 children.
  • Ensure the safety and well-being of all children. This includes ensuring children apply sunscreen and stay hydrated.
  • Know where all group members are at all times.
  • Lead games and activities.
  • Maintain appearance of camp through cleanliness and set-up.
  • Take daily attendance and see that each child is signed in and out by a responsible party each day.
  • Actively engage children and participants in activities.
  • Prepare and distribute USDA and HEPA approved snacks and/or meals to participants.
  • Perform daily count of meals and snacks served.
  • Report all injuries and incidents to the Director or Coordinator.
  • Display YMCA character values (Honesty, caring, respect, and responsibility) at all times.
  • Required to swim at least two times per week.
Requirements
  • Must have an interest in and like children and exemplify and support the YMCA philosophy.
  • Must have a high school diploma or GED or be actively enrolled in high school.
  • Must be 18 years of age.
  • Must have current CPR certification, First Aid, AED, and CO2 (Training provided by the Y, if needed).
